    Does Jellyfin support having both a multipart movie and additional editions in the same folder/landing page? I tried with the following naming scheme:
       
    It seems the muli-version aspect of the naming worked, but I have no idea where the PT2 ended up and it does not auto play at the end of part one.
       

    Any help would be greatly appreciated.

    AFAIK, you cannot use both "versions" and multi-part in the same movie. Another user asked this question and they merged the two parts with MKVToolnix.
